We're sorry but Hotel Alerts doesn't work properly without JavaScript enabled. Please enable it to continue.
Global
>
South Africa
>
Cassini Tower
Hotels in Cassini Tower, South Africa
Epic Getaway in Waterfall - Karkloof Crescent Ellipse Waterfall